Mission
The Youth Educational Empowerment Program teaches financial literacy to young people from birth to 24. Our most notable accomplishment is the completion of a three year survey measuring the financial knowledge of high school students in the Wichita and surrounding area. This data will be used to provide areas of greatest need as well as debt producing habits that face our young generation today.
